import { type ComponentType, type ReactNode } from 'react';
type ReactComponent<P> = ReactNode | ComponentType<P>;
/**
 * Appropriately renders ReactNode, component types, or component instances.
 * Handles different input types and returns the appropriate rendered output.
 * @typeParam P - The component props type
 * @param Component - The ReactNode or component to render
 * @param props - Props to pass to the component
 * @returns The rendered ReactNode or null
 * @example
 * // Returns ReactElement as-is
 * renderComponent(<div>Content</div>)
 *
 * // Instantiates component type and returns it
 * renderComponent(MyComponent, { prop1: 'value1' })
 *
 * // Returns null for invalid values
 * renderComponent(undefined)
 */
export declare const renderComponent: <P extends object>(Component: ReactComponent<P>, props?: P) => ReactNode;
